Can you clearly link your aims, outcomes and impact in your funding applications?

Posted by Bianca

This interactive training session will help you to clearly link your aimsoutcomes and activities in your applications.

Many major funders now require you to do this, and if you’re not, or not doing it well, it could affect your chances of success.

In this session you will explore a systematic approach to planning aims, outcomes and impact in your funding applications.

This session will help you:

• Describe your project in terms of what need or needs your project will tackle
• Distinguish between aims, outcomes, indicators and activities and suggest clear examples for each one
• Apply an aim, outcome and indicator for a project that relates back to the need for the project
• Apply the use of the planning triangle to a project.

This session is aimed at anyone currently working on, or planning, a funding application.

Previous participants have said they learnt:

“The clear difference between outcomes and outputs and what it is that major funders want to see in an application.”

“The importance of stating clear and measurable aims and outcomes.”

“Start by looking at need before activity. Consider fewer quality outcomes.”
